Mauve, a pale purple shade with a hint of gray, incorporates a abundant and intriguing historical past. The color was first discovered in 1856 by a youthful chemist named William Henry Perkin. For the age of just 18, Perkin was attempting to synthesize quinine, a treatment for malaria, from coal tar. As an alternative, he accidentally developed a whole new synthetic dye, which he named mauveine. This discovery revolutionized the textile market, as it was the initial artificial dye being produced on a substantial scale. Mauve rapidly turned common in style and structure, and its creation marked the beginning on the artificial dye sector. The colour was named following the French term for your mallow flower, that has an identical pale purple hue. Mauve turned synonymous with luxury and sophistication, and it stays a favorite colour in many industries to this day.

Mauve's popularity continued to mature through the entire late nineteenth century, and it turned connected with the Aesthetic motion in artwork and style. The Aesthetic motion, which emerged during the 1860s, emphasized the significance of magnificence and artwork for art's sake. Mauve was a favorite shade among the Aesthetic artists and designers, who used it inside their paintings, textiles, and attractive arts. The colour's soft, muted tones have been seen as a departure from your garish shades with the Victorian period, and it arrived to symbolize refinement and class. Mauve's Affiliation Using the Aesthetic movement helped solidify its spot on this planet of artwork and style and design, and it continues to be a favorite option for Those people trying to get a classy and timeless coloration palette.
